Palletizer - SCARA
Main features
Technical details
 

 

description
Scara geometry robots are able to pick up from multiple rollers and deposit on multiple pallets at the same time, while maintaining reduced clearance and excellent performance.
Specifications
  • Interpolated 4-axis movement, 120 kg load at the wrist.
  • +/-0.5 mm repeatability with maximum load and speed over the entire workspace.
  • The 2,100 x 2,500 mm high workspace radius is specifically designed for palletizing.
  • Up to 1,400 mm/sec linear speed.
  • Dedicated pneumatic and electrical connections (8 digital inputs + 8 digital outputs) at the wrist to allow simplified gripper integration.
  • Ergonomic touch screen LCD programming keyboard for intuitive process control.
    The CodeSys axis controller complies with standard IEC 61131-3, which standardizes PLC, SoftPLC and CNC programming systems by the main manufacturers in the world (Siemens, AllenBradley, etc.).
  • Sealed bearings and AC brushless motors for better protection and reliability.
advantages
The high load capacity of this robot means it is possible to palletize multiple packages at the same time thus maximizing system productivity.
The robot controller is connected to the outside world by multiple interfaces.
For example, the robot can be inserted on the factory LAN (Ethernet) for dialogue with ERP systems and/or to remote control production stops or progress.
Appliance maintenance is reduced and simplified by the LCD panel that displays any work required during the entire life of the system. Each time maintenance is needed, the operator is guided through all the recommended check ups and/or procedures required to always achieve the best performance.
High performance brushless motors are assembled on the robots to reduce consumption (thanks to an active circuit that recovers any current generated during braking) and to increase dynamic performance.
Applications
Infeed and pick-up systems are specially designed to ease format changeovers and provide maximum flexibility during future expansions.
The infeeds are synchronized with the packaging machine upstream of the robot to optimize the product flow.
options
The LCD control panel can be equipped with various cable lengths for greater installation flexibility. Pallet labelling system and/or communication system with the centralized factory traceability database to integrate the robot with the factory quality management system.
Visual control camera to check the conformity of products entering the palletization zone.
AUTOMATIC PALLETIZING

The robot features a series of pre-installed palletizing programs which can be used to make slight variations to some parameters (such as the number of layers, offset between packages, interlayer cardboard, etc.) thanks to the practical standard hand-held interface.
A software package called AUTOPAL has been designed for applications requiring greater flexibility and customer autonomy. AUTOPAL allows the operator to automatically create, archive and modify palletizing programs.
